Courses from 1000+ universities
Online learning can be more than content delivery. It can be where community happens.
600 Free Google Certifications
Finance
Psychology
Web Development
Python for Data Science
Mindfulness for Wellbeing and Peak Performance
Unlocking Information Security I: From Cryptography to Buffer Overflows
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Pluralsight connects technology professionals with the best learning resources to develop in-demand skills and stay competitive.
Developing teamwork skills can be difficult if you don’t know where to start or what area to focus on. This course will teach you everything you need to know to develop your own teamwork skills and understand the importance of this soft skill.
Games are complicated systems with lots of moving parts and interconnected components. In this course, Swords and Shovels: Game Managers, Loaders, and the Game Loop, you will learn how to implement tools to manage these complications as you build large…
This course will teach you how to effectively lead a successful team by establishing goals, roles, and guidelines that work.
In this course, you'll learn the basics of Azure DevOps builds. You'll learn how to build your application, manage its complex dependencies, and implement a number of practices to make your build work for you and your organization.
In this course, C# Reflection, you’ll learn how to use reflection in C# 12. First, you’ll explore for which use cases reflection can be useful. Next, you’ll discover how to use reflection to inspect & manipulate classes and objects at runtime. Final…
Year after year the world is generating more and more data, and to process it we need better and more sophisticated tools. Apache Flink is a new, next generation Big Data processing tool that is capable of complex stream and batch data processing. In t…
Nearly every game today utilizes physics in some fashion. This course, Unity Physics Fundamentals, will give you the knowledge you need to understand Unity's physics engine and allow you create rich, simulated experiences. First, you'll learn to work w…
Learn what Property-based Testing is, and how to write and run such tests with F#.
This course introduces ASP.NET developers to the Stripe payments library, an API that allows developers to quickly accept payments in ASP.NET web applications.
Master Java memory management techniques to diagnose and fix OutOfMemoryErrors, memory leaks, and performance issues using practical tools and proven debugging strategies.
Websites don't always work as expected. In this course, Debugging Your Website with Fiddler and Chrome DevTools, you will learn foundational knowledge necessary to debug website problems. First, you will learn diagnostic techniques. Next, you will disc…
This course focuses on two major topics: Modern Cisco solution API usage and application deployment strategies. In this course, Consuming Cisco APIs and Understanding Application DevOps, you will gain the ability to deploy, test, and manage application…
At the core of any successful project that involves a real world dataset is a thorough knowledge of how to clean that dataset from missing, bad, or inaccurate data. In this course, Cleaning Data: Python Data Playbook, you'll learn how to use pandas to…
Life is about waiting, so how about for once letting Python wait for you? Generators and coroutines are Python's main ingredients for lazy programming and letting code run concurrently in the same thread. In this course, Advanced Generators and Corouti…
Managing servers on a Windows network with no tooling can be difficult and tedious, and trying to manually make changes consistently across a network of dozens or hundreds of servers on an Active Directory domain will invariably lead to mistakes. In t…
Get personalized course recommendations, track subjects and courses with reminders, and more.